Ingredients

1)Rice-3 cups
2)Mysore Dal-1 cup
3)Onion-3 big ones
4)Pudina-a handful
5)Curry Leaves-a handful
6)Green chilly-4
7)Oil-5 table spoons
8)Ghee-1 table spoon
9)Bay leaves-2
10)Garlic
11)Ginger (grated)
12)cardomon
13)elaichi
14)crystal salt -4 tea spoons
15)Cashew nuts

First of all wash the rice & dal just once & drain the water out completely.Pour some oil in the cooker & add the cashew nuts bay leaves,cardomon,elaichi.After about a minute add the grated ginger & the garlic,keep frying for about 2 mintutes.Now add the Sliced onion & keep frying till the onion turns slight brown.Now add the slited green chilly,pudina leaves,curry leaves & crystal salt & mix well.
Keeping mixing well so that things dont get burnt at the bottom of the cooker.Now add the rice+dal & mix them well slowly.Leave for about a minute till you hear/see the rice sputter a little bit at the bottom.Now add about 8 cups of water (3/4 full in the glass).Stir the contents well.cover the cooker and leave it till the steam comes out which would take about 5minutes.Now place the weight over the cooker & allow it to cook till the whistle blows once or for about 15-20 minutes.Allow for a standing time of about 5 minutes.Open the cooker & transfer the contents to the Casserol....Serve it with curds,cucumber,onion,tomato,chat masala raitha...
